How can less people working in the service industry help to improve the economy?

Fewer people working in the service industry can encourage businesses to innovate and adopt automation, leading to increased productivity and efficiency. This shift can drive economic growth by allowing companies to focus on higher-value activities and invest in technology. Additionally, a smaller workforce in the service sector may lead to better wages and working conditions as employers compete for skilled labor. Overall, this transition can stimulate a more diversified economy with a focus on higher-skilled jobs.
